FlowMotion Hydraulics & Instruments is a leading manufacturer of high-quality stainless steel (SS304 / SS316) needle valves designed for precise flow control in high-pressure industrial, hydraulic, and instrumentation systems. Our needle valves provide accurate throttling, smooth operation, and tight shut-off performance even under demanding operating conditions.
We manufacture precision-engineered screwed needle valves and high-pressure needle valves suitable for oil & gas applications, chemical processing plants, hydraulic systems, instrumentation lines, and industrial pipelines across India.
Our SS needle valves are widely appreciated for low operating torque, high tensile strength, corrosion resistance, and leak-proof sealing. These valves are ideal for isolation, calibration, and draining of process lines where a constant and calibrated low flow rate must be maintained.

| Inlet / Outlet Size | 1/4″ to 2″ |
|---|---|
| Connection Type | NPT, BSP, BSPT, Socket Weld, Butt Weld, Flanged |
| Materials of Construction | SS304, SS316, Carbon Steel |
| Maximum Operating Pressure | 3000 / 6000 / 10000 / 15000 PSI |
| Flow Coefficient (CV) | Standard 0.35 – 2.30 (Depending on Size) |
| Operating Temperature | -54°C (-65°F) to +538°C (+1000°F) |
| Seat Type | Metal to Metal |
| Packing Material | PTFE / Graphite (Optional) |
| Mounting Option | Panel / Base Mount |
